Alex is shopping at Ozone Galleria Mall. There is a dedicated cubicle for a type of...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
Alex is shopping at Ozone Galleria Mall. There is a dedicated cubicle for a type of product at the shopping center. All the products sold at the ith cubicle are priced the same, denoted by prices[i]. The cubicles are arranged such that the price of the products sold at each cubicle are in non- decreasing order. Several queries would be asked in the problem. In each query, the cubicle number Alex is initially standing at, and the amount of money Alex has is given, and Alex can travel in the right direction visiting from the current cubicle to the last cubicle. Alex may buy at most one item from any cubicle visited, but the total cost of the purchase must not exceed the amount Alex has. Report the maximum number of products that can be purchased for each query. More formally, given an array of n integers, prices, where prices[i] denotes the price of the product sold in the th cubicle. The array prices are in non-decreasing order (i.e., price[i] s price[i+1]), and q queries need to be processed. For each query, two integers are given: • pos: Alex's initial position amount: the amount of money Alex has Alex needs to visit each cubicle from number pos to n, purchasing at most one product from each cubicle. For each query, the goal is to find the maximum number of products that Alex can buy. Alex is shopping at Ozone Galleria Mall. There is a dedicated cubicle for a type of product at the shopping center. All the products sold at the ith cubicle are priced the same, denoted by prices[i]. The cubicles are arranged such that the price of the products sold at each cubicle are in non- decreasing order. Several queries would be asked in the problem. In each query, the cubicle number Alex is initially standing at, and the amount of money Alex has is given, and Alex can travel in the right direction visiting from the current cubicle to the last cubicle. Alex may buy at most one item from any cubicle visited, but the total cost of the purchase must not exceed the amount Alex has. Report the maximum number of products that can be purchased for each query. More formally, given an array of n integers, prices, where prices[i] denotes the price of the product sold in the th cubicle. The array prices are in non-decreasing order (i.e., price[i] s price[i+1]), and q queries need to be processed. For each query, two integers are given: • pos: Alex's initial position amount: the amount of money Alex has Alex needs to visit each cubicle from number pos to n, purchasing at most one product from each cubicle. For each query, the goal is to find the maximum number of products that Alex can buy.
Expert Answer:
Answer rating: 100% (QA)
To solve this problem we can use a sliding window approach We start at the initial position given by pos and move towards the right We maintain a wind... View the full answer
Related Book For
Posted Date:
Students also viewed these finance questions
-
Planning is one of the most important management functions in any business. A front office managers first step in planning should involve determine the departments goals. Planning also includes...
-
Managing Scope Changes Case Study Scope changes on a project can occur regardless of how well the project is planned or executed. Scope changes can be the result of something that was omitted during...
-
Read the case study "Southwest Airlines," found in Part 2 of your textbook. Review the "Guide to Case Analysis" found on pp. CA1 - CA11 of your textbook. (This guide follows the last case in the...
-
Assuming @Weather is a valid repeatable annotation that takes a String, with its associated containing type annotation @Forecast, which of the following can be applied to a type declaration? (Choose...
-
C++ type hierarchies could be used to define device drivers by encoding standard operations for all devices in a base class and then refining the behavior for various devices with derived classes....
-
What is the critical angle for total internal reflection for an optical fiber cable surrounded by air if the index of refraction is (a) 1. 4 and (b) 1. 8 ? (c) Which fiber could have a sharper bend...
-
Cobra Golf Club Corp. had the following stockholders' equity at December 31, 2007: On June 30, 2008, Cobra split its common stock 2 for 1. Make the memorandum entry to record the stock split, and...
-
Diamond Slope Company produces snow skis. Each ski requires 2 pounds of carbon fiber. The companys management predicts that 7,000 skis and 10,000 pounds of carbon fiber will be in inventory on June...
-
For fhe ghown Wall\'s 5 layers, use normal concrete of K = 1 7 W m . K , if the Ara of the Wall is 2 4 m 2 nat A t = 2 0 * C , H = C H m k w R o - 0 . 0 5 m r 2 k w Find the heat los through this...
-
Consolidation related simulation example: Millennium Capital Management, Inc., (MCM) acquired a 90% interest in NextGen, Inc. MCM's Financial Manager, Matthew Steven, has prepared a draft memo to the...
-
Gandalf Ltd has a year end of 31 December. On 30 October 2020 it classified an item of plant as held for sale. At that date the plant had a carrying amount of 13,200 and had been accounted for...
-
22K. A highway is parallel to a railroad track and a car is approaching a train as shown. The train sounds a 500-Hz whistle on a day when the velocity of sound is 350m/s. (a) Is the sound traveling...
-
Grixdale Tax Services prepares taxes for individuals. Grixdale offers a simplified pricing model with two alternatives for taxpayers: Standard Deduction ( Standard ) or Itemized Deductions ( Itemized...
-
The only current debt in the business is a 6m loan from Barclays in 2016 which was used to open and upgrade a new warehouse. The loan matures in 2023 and 95% of it has been repaid. Find Enterprise...
-
what ways can an individual demonstrate empathetic resonance with diverse perspectives and experiences ?
-
Consider the following information in Figure 1 below for a portfolio including security A and security B: Figure 1 State of the economy Probability of state of economy Boom Growth Normal Recession...
-
What is the concept of resonance, and how is it utilized in electrical and mechanical engineering, such as in designing circuits or tuning musical instruments?
-
Write a paper about the Working relationship in the organization- collaboration within and outside the organization
-
The local supermarket is considering investing in self- checkout kiosks for its customers. The self- checkout kiosks will cost $ 46,000 and have no residual value. Management expects the equipment to...
-
Return to the original SeaView example in Exhibits 5- 5 and 5- 7. Suppose direct labor is $ 34,000 rather than $ 21,250. Now what is the conversion cost per equivalent unit? C H
-
Jubilee Frozen Foods purchased new computer- controlled production machinery last year from Advanced Design. The equipment was purchased for $ 4.1 million and was paid for with cash. A representative...
-
The trial balance of Alpha Graphics at October 31, 2007, follows, along with the data for the month-end adjustments. Adjusting data at October 31: a. Unearned service revenue still unearned, \(\$...
-
The unadjusted T-accounts of Investors Brokerage at December 31, 2007 , and the related year-end adjustment data follow. Adjustment data at December 31, 2007. a. Depreciation for the year, \(\$...
-
The unadiusted trial balance of Jen Weaver Insurance at April 30, 2008, follow's on the next page. Adjustment data at April 30, 2008, consist of a. Accrued service revenue, \(\$ 1,600\). b....
Study smarter with the SolutionInn App